Integrated Growth StrategistAbout Cro Metrics

At Cro Metrics, we’re on a mission to redefine growth for organizations and brands through unparalleled digital experiences that inspire action and deliver results. With transformative experimentation as our guide, we bridge bold ideas with practical solutions to create lasting impact.

We are a growth optimization agency that partners with mission-driven and high-growth companies to scale through data-driven experimentation. Our expertise spans A/B testing, personalization, paid media, and full-funnel digital strategy—empowering clients to make smarter decisions that drive measurable results.

Our fully remote team of strategists, analysts, engineers, and designers works across industries including eCommerce, fintech, nonprofit, and hospitality. We believe in autonomy, collaboration, and innovation as we help our clients grow smarter and faster.

About the Role

As an Integrated Growth Strategist, you’ll lead experimentation and optimization programs that uncover, validate, and scale opportunities driving measurable business impact. You’ll take a holistic view of the customer journey — analyzing how prospects and customers engage across channels and lifecycle stages — to inform integrated growth strategies that improve acquisition, conversion, retention, and lifetime value.

You’ll balance analytical rigor with creative insight, using data-driven experimentation to guide marketing and experience improvements that connect directly to client goals. With strength in lifecycle marketing and a broad understanding of related disciplines — including paid media, conversion optimization, and analytics — you’ll collaborate with specialists across functions to design and deliver cohesive, high-impact experimentation roadmaps.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ead integrated growth programs for assigned clients, owning priorities, outcomes, and overall customer journey analysis.
  • Build and manage testing roadmaps aligned with client KPIs, business objectives, and lifecycle stages.
  • Translate research, data, and customer behavior insights into actionable hypotheses and test strategies.
  • Analyze experiment and channel performance to uncover friction points and opportunities across acquisition, nurture, conversion, and retention touchpoints.
  • Partner with channel and functional specialists (CRO, paid media, lifecycle, analytics, SEO) to deliver coordinated testing strategies that improve full-funnel performance.
  • Present findings and recommendations with clarity, connecting insights to strategic implications and measurable business outcomes.
  • Identify opportunities for program expansion, marketing automation, and cross-channel innovation.
What Makes a Great IGS
  • 4–6 years in digital growth, marketing strategy, or experimentation roles (agency experience preferred).
  • Demonstrated success linking experimentation and optimization to measurable growth outcomes.
  • Strength in lifecycle marketing (nurture, email, automation) with a general understanding of paid media, CRO, and analytics.
  • Hands-on experience with marketing automation platforms such as HubSpot, Marketo, or Klaviyo.
  • Familiarity with SEO principles and how organic channels contribute to the customer journey.
  • Confident communicator who balances data-driven analysis with creative insight and client context.
  • Proven bias for action, accountability, and curiosity to learn across multiple marketing disciplines.
What Motivates You
  • You love finding the “why” behind customer behavior and performance trends.
  • You’re energized by connecting data and storytelling to clarify complex problems.
  • You’re passionate about improving the end-to-end customer experience through experimentation and growth strategy.
  • You thrive in fast-paced, collaborative environments where you can help shape client marketing programs holistically.

Compensation: 

  • We’re hiring for the Integrated Growth Strategist role, with a compensation range of $90,000–$110,000. A Senior Integrated Growth Strategist range ($110,000–$130,000) may be considered for candidates whose experience aligns with that scope. Final title and compensation will be determined through the interview process.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
